Output 5330095cc58d13515ac2ea8c2a884bc6c7199eef9a5e37fd9f374c78e020140b:4

value
22631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 418eee6ded82ffaabf15eda4f04c9074a222bc53 OP_EQUAL
address
37ff54KaoK5HTxy27ZH8u3A97CtrEkdCFf
transaction
5330095cc58d13515ac2ea8c2a884bc6c7199eef9a5e37fd9f374c78e020140b
spent
true